The Rise of Robots in Manufacturing
In a significant move towards automation, Toyota is embracing technology to improve efficiency in its factories. With the deployment of 436 Geekplus autonomous mobile robots (AMRs), the auto giant seeks to enhance its production and logistics operations. These robots are designed to assist in moving materials from one point to another within the factories, automating what was once a manual task, thus paving the way for a more efficient manufacturing environment.
Why Toyota Chose Geekplus Robots
Toyota's decision to utilize Geekplus robots stems from the growing pressures of labor shortages in Japan’s manufacturing sector. As the population ages and fewer workers enter the workforce, companies like Toyota are turning to automation to meet production demands. These robots not only help in moving goods throughout the production process but also ensure that workers' physical workload is reduced, creating a safer workspace.
How AMRs Improve Safety and Productivity
The introduction of AMRs helps to reduce accidents in factories. By replacing manual transportation tasks, the robots lessen the risk of collisions between human-operated forklifts and towing vehicles. This technological advance not only enhances safety but also improves overall productivity. The robots can operate without human intervention, allowing for continuous work without fatigue, a crucial factor in busy manufacturing settings.
Adapting to Production Needs with Flexibility
One of the standout features of the Geekplus AMRs is their flexibility. These robots use sensors and software to navigate their surroundings and can easily adapt to changes in production lines. This adaptability is essential for manufacturers dealing with various products, enabling them to efficiently handle both high-volume and low-volume production needs without compromising quality and speed.
